  1. // Copyright 2015 The Chromium Authors. All rights reserved.
  2. // Use of this source code is governed by a BSD-style license that can be
  3. // found in the LICENSE file.
  4. #include "components/sync/driver/sync_stopped_reporter.h"
  5. #include "base/bind.h"
  6. #include "base/run_loop.h"
  7. #include "base/test/bind.h"
  8. #include "base/test/scoped_mock_time_message_loop_task_runner.h"
  9. #include "base/test/task_environment.h"
  10. #include "components/sync/protocol/sync.pb.h"
  11. #include "net/http/http_status_code.h"
  12. #include "net/http/http_util.h"
  13. #include "services/network/public/cpp/resource_request.h"
  14. #include "services/network/public/cpp/shared_url_loader_factory.h"
  15. #include "services/network/public/cpp/weak_wrapper_shared_url_loader_factory.h"
  16. #include "services/network/test/test_url_loader_factory.h"
  17. #include "services/network/test/test_utils.h"
  18. #include "testing/gtest/include/gtest/gtest.h"
  19. namespace syncer {
  20. const char kTestURL[] = "http://chromium.org/test";
  21. const char kTestURLTrailingSlash[] = "http://chromium.org/test/";
  22. const char kEventURL[] = "http://chromium.org/test/event";
  23. const char kTestUserAgent[] = "the_fifth_element";
  24. const char kAuthToken[] = "multipass";
  25. const char kCacheGuid[] = "leeloo";
  26. const char kBirthday[] = "2263";
  27. const char kAuthHeaderPrefix[] = "Bearer ";
  28. class SyncStoppedReporterTest : public testing::Test {
  29. public:
  30. SyncStoppedReporterTest(const SyncStoppedReporterTest&) = delete;
  31. SyncStoppedReporterTest& operator=(const SyncStoppedReporterTest&) = delete;
  32. protected:
  33. SyncStoppedReporterTest() = default;
  34. ~SyncStoppedReporterTest() override = default;
  35. void SetUp() override {
  36. test_shared_loader_factory_ =
  37. base::MakeRefCounted<network::WeakWrapperSharedURLLoaderFactory>(
  38. url_loader_factory());
  39. }
  40. void RequestFinishedCallback(const SyncStoppedReporter::Result& result) {
  41. request_result_ = result;
  42. }
  43. GURL interception_url(const GURL& url) {
  44. return SyncStoppedReporter::GetSyncEventURL(url);
  45. }
  46. GURL test_url() { return GURL(kTestURL); }
  47. void call_on_timeout(SyncStoppedReporter* ssr) { ssr->OnTimeout(); }
  48. std::string user_agent() const { return std::string(kTestUserAgent); }
  49. SyncStoppedReporter::ResultCallback callback() {
  50. return base::BindOnce(&SyncStoppedReporterTest::RequestFinishedCallback,
  51. base::Unretained(this));
  52. }
  53. const SyncStoppedReporter::Result& request_result() const {
  54. return request_result_;
  55. }
  56. network::TestURLLoaderFactory* url_loader_factory() {
  57. return &test_url_loader_factory_;
  58. }
  59. scoped_refptr<network::SharedURLLoaderFactory> shared_url_loader_factory() {
  60. return test_shared_loader_factory_;
  61. }
  62. private:
  63. base::test::SingleThreadTaskEnvironment task_environment_;
  64. network::TestURLLoaderFactory test_url_loader_factory_;
  65. scoped_refptr<network::SharedURLLoaderFactory> test_shared_loader_factory_;
  66. SyncStoppedReporter::Result request_result_;
  67. };
  68. // Test that the event URL gets constructed correctly.
  69. TEST_F(SyncStoppedReporterTest, EventURL) {
  70. GURL intercepted_url;
  71. url_loader_factory()->AddResponse(interception_url(GURL(kTestURL)).spec(),
  72. "");
  73. url_loader_factory()->SetInterceptor(
  74. base::BindLambdaForTesting([&](const network::ResourceRequest& request) {
  75. intercepted_url = request.url;
  76. }));
  77. SyncStoppedReporter ssr(GURL(kTestURL), user_agent(),
  78. shared_url_loader_factory(), callback());
  79. ssr.ReportSyncStopped(kAuthToken, kCacheGuid, kBirthday);
  80. EXPECT_EQ(kEventURL, intercepted_url.spec());
  81. }
  82. // Test that the event URL gets constructed correctly with a trailing slash.
  83. TEST_F(SyncStoppedReporterTest, EventURLWithSlash) {
  84. GURL intercepted_url;
  85. url_loader_factory()->AddResponse(
  86. interception_url(GURL(kTestURLTrailingSlash)).spec(), "");
  87. url_loader_factory()->SetInterceptor(
  88. base::BindLambdaForTesting([&](const network::ResourceRequest& request) {
  89. intercepted_url = request.url;
  90. }));
  91. SyncStoppedReporter ssr(GURL(kTestURLTrailingSlash), user_agent(),
  92. shared_url_loader_factory(), callback());
  93. ssr.ReportSyncStopped(kAuthToken, kCacheGuid, kBirthday);
  94. EXPECT_EQ(kEventURL, intercepted_url.spec());
  95. }
  96. // Test that the URLFetcher gets configured correctly.
  97. TEST_F(SyncStoppedReporterTest, FetcherConfiguration) {
  98. GURL intercepted_url;
  99. net::HttpRequestHeaders intercepted_headers;
  100. std::string intercepted_body;
  101. url_loader_factory()->AddResponse(interception_url(test_url()).spec(), "");
  102. url_loader_factory()->SetInterceptor(
  103. base::BindLambdaForTesting([&](const network::ResourceRequest& request) {
  104. intercepted_url = request.url;
  105. intercepted_headers = request.headers;
  106. intercepted_body = network::GetUploadData(request);
  107. }));
  108. SyncStoppedReporter ssr(test_url(), user_agent(), shared_url_loader_factory(),
  109. callback());
  110. ssr.ReportSyncStopped(kAuthToken, kCacheGuid, kBirthday);
  111. // Ensure the headers are set correctly.
  112. std::string header;
  113. intercepted_headers.GetHeader(net::HttpRequestHeaders::kAuthorization,
  114. &header);
  115. std::string auth_header(kAuthHeaderPrefix);
  116. auth_header.append(kAuthToken);
  117. EXPECT_EQ(auth_header, header);
  118. intercepted_headers.GetHeader(net::HttpRequestHeaders::kUserAgent, &header);
  119. EXPECT_EQ(user_agent(), header);
  120. sync_pb::EventRequest event_request;
  121. event_request.ParseFromString(intercepted_body);
  122. EXPECT_EQ(kCacheGuid, event_request.sync_disabled().cache_guid());
  123. EXPECT_EQ(kBirthday, event_request.sync_disabled().store_birthday());
  124. EXPECT_EQ(kEventURL, intercepted_url.spec());
  125. }
  126. TEST_F(SyncStoppedReporterTest, HappyCase) {
  127. url_loader_factory()->AddResponse(interception_url(test_url()).spec(), "");
  128. SyncStoppedReporter ssr(test_url(), user_agent(), shared_url_loader_factory(),
  129. callback());
  130. ssr.ReportSyncStopped(kAuthToken, kCacheGuid, kBirthday);
  131. base::RunLoop run_loop;
  132. run_loop.RunUntilIdle();
  133. EXPECT_EQ(SyncStoppedReporter::RESULT_SUCCESS, request_result());
  134. }
  135. TEST_F(SyncStoppedReporterTest, ServerNotFound) {
  136. url_loader_factory()->AddResponse(interception_url(test_url()).spec(), "",
  137. net::HTTP_NOT_FOUND);
  138. SyncStoppedReporter ssr(test_url(), user_agent(), shared_url_loader_factory(),
  139. callback());
  140. ssr.ReportSyncStopped(kAuthToken, kCacheGuid, kBirthday);
  141. base::RunLoop run_loop;
  142. run_loop.RunUntilIdle();
  143. EXPECT_EQ(SyncStoppedReporter::RESULT_ERROR, request_result());
  144. }
  145. TEST_F(SyncStoppedReporterTest, Timeout) {
  146. url_loader_factory()->AddResponse(interception_url(test_url()).spec(), "");
  147. // Mock the underlying loop's clock to trigger the timer at will.
  148. base::ScopedMockTimeMessageLoopTaskRunner mock_main_runner;
  149. SyncStoppedReporter ssr(test_url(), user_agent(), shared_url_loader_factory(),
  150. callback());
  151. // Begin request.
  152. ssr.ReportSyncStopped(kAuthToken, kCacheGuid, kBirthday);
  153. // Trigger the timeout.
  154. ASSERT_TRUE(mock_main_runner->HasPendingTask());
  155. call_on_timeout(&ssr);
  156. mock_main_runner->FastForwardUntilNoTasksRemain();
  157. EXPECT_EQ(SyncStoppedReporter::RESULT_TIMEOUT, request_result());
  158. }
  159. TEST_F(SyncStoppedReporterTest, NoCallback) {
  160. url_loader_factory()->AddResponse(interception_url(GURL(kTestURL)).spec(),
  161. "");
  162. SyncStoppedReporter ssr(GURL(kTestURL), user_agent(),
  163. shared_url_loader_factory(),
  164. SyncStoppedReporter::ResultCallback());
  165. ssr.ReportSyncStopped(kAuthToken, kCacheGuid, kBirthday);
  166. base::RunLoop run_loop;
  167. run_loop.RunUntilIdle();
  168. }
  169. TEST_F(SyncStoppedReporterTest, NoCallbackTimeout) {
  170. url_loader_factory()->AddResponse(interception_url(GURL(kTestURL)).spec(),
  171. "");
  172. // Mock the underlying loop's clock to trigger the timer at will.
  173. base::ScopedMockTimeMessageLoopTaskRunner mock_main_runner;
  174. SyncStoppedReporter ssr(GURL(kTestURL), user_agent(),
  175. shared_url_loader_factory(),
  176. SyncStoppedReporter::ResultCallback());
  177. // Begin request.
  178. ssr.ReportSyncStopped(kAuthToken, kCacheGuid, kBirthday);
  179. // Trigger the timeout.
  180. ASSERT_TRUE(mock_main_runner->HasPendingTask());
  181. call_on_timeout(&ssr);
  182. mock_main_runner->FastForwardUntilNoTasksRemain();
  183. }
